            A Toast to the Millennium!!

                   

            May you get a clean bill of health from your dentist, your
            cardiologist, your gastro-enterologist, your podiatrist,
            your psychiatrist, your plumber and the I.R.S.

            May your hair, your teeth, your face-lift, your abs and
            your stocks not fall; may your blood pressure, your
            triglycerides, your cholesterol, your white blood count
            and your mortgage interest not rise.

            May you find a way to travel from anywhere to anywhere in
            the rush hour in less than an hour, and when you get there
            may you find a parking space.

            May Friday evening, December 31st, find you seated around
            the table with your beloved family and cherished friends.

            May you find the food better, the environment quieter, the
            cost much cheaper, and the pleasure much more fulfilling
            than anything else you might ordinarily do that night.

            May you wake up on January 1st, finding that the world has
            not come to an "end", the lights work, the water faucets
            flow, and the sky has not fallen.

            May you go to the bank on Monday morning, January 3rd and
            find your account is in order, your money is still there
            and any mistakes are in your favor.

            May you ponder on January 4th; How did this ultra-modern
            civilization of ours manage to get itself traumatized by
            a possible slip of a blip on a chip made out of sand.

            May we relax about the Third Millennium of the Common Era,
            and realize that, we still have 240 years until the dawn
            of the Sixth Millennium of the Jewish calendar by which
            time the computer is long since obsolete and so are we.

            May what you see in the mirror delight you, and what others
            see in you delight them.

            May someone love you enough to forgive your faults, be blind
            to your blemishes, and tell the world about your virtues.

            May the telemarketers wait to make their sales calls until
            you finish dinner, and may your check book and your budget
            balance, and may they include generous amounts for charity.

            May you remember to say "I love you" at least once a day to
            your spouse, your child, your parent; but not to your
            secretary, your nurse, your masseuse, your hair-dresser or
            your tennis instructor.

            May we live in a world at peace and with the awareness of
            God's love in every sunset, every flower's unfolding petals,
            every baby's smile, every animal's grin, every lover's kiss,
            and every wonderful, astonishing,
            miraculous beat of our heart.
